About The Position

The Salesforce Development Manager is responsible for leading the strategy, design, and delivery of scalable Salesforce solutions that support key business capabilities across Sales, Service, and other enterprise functions. This role serves as both a technical and functional leader, driving platform optimization, enabling business teams, and ensuring Salesforce is leveraged as a strategic growth engine. The ideal candidate combines deep Salesforce expertise with strong stakeholder partnership, enabling the delivery of high-impact solutions that improve efficiency, enhance user experience, and support data-driven decision making.

Requirements

  • Minimum of 3 years of experience of managing Financial and Procurement application development teams.
  • Minimum of 3 years of experience managing teams through all phases of the technology lifecycle from initial deployment through retirement.
  • Experience managing multiple teams comprised of offshore, nearshore, and local members.
  • Experience managing systems in a hybrid environment of Premise and SaaS
  • Experience supporting complex systems with significant integration points and external Third Party systems through APIs.
  • Thorough understanding and proven delivery experience with both traditional and Agile (Scrum/Kanban) project methodologies.
  • Experience with Agile tools such as Rally and Confluence.
  • Experience with change management, incident management, and root cause analysis.
  • Experience with Lawson Financials and SAP Ariba.
  • Minimum 5 years of experience managing software development teams.
  • Minimum 5 years of experience working in software development.

Responsibilities

  • Manages competing priorities, workloads and activities to achieve multiple project objectives and ensures that information systems are defect free and meet end-user requirements.
  • Develops and maintains productive working relationships with project sponsors and key systems users.
  • Stays current on software development techniques and drives improvements in support of application development efforts.
  • Participates in all phases of the Software Development Life Cycle (SDLC).
  • Plans and manages budgets, forecasts, projects and associated staffing requirements.
  • Ensures that service delivery meets agreed to service levels.
  • Diagnoses service delivery problems to identify actions required to maintain or improve levels of service.
  • Develops strong relationships with key vendors providing components of the department’s services.
  • Responsible for the hiring, promotion, associate performance evaluation, training, motivation, counseling, and discipline of employees.
  • Fosters collaborative cross-functional partnerships across technology and business teams to ensure project goals are consistently met.
  • Actively leads the evolution of the Finance and Procurement components of the Information Technology departments’ 5-year plan.
